mod_lua no apache e mod_v8

30/12/2008

Duas notícias interessantes do blog do Paul Querna:

O mod_lua foi incluído no apache 2.4. No exemplo em seu blog, ele demonstra que regras complicadas do mod_rewrite poderão ser escritas em lua, usando uma sintaxe de if/else mais comum.

Outro notícia interessante: ele fez um esboço de um módulo para embutir a máquina virtual de Javascript v8 num módulo do apache. Foi feito por enquanto mais por brincadeira, mas vale lembrar que muita gente acredita em JavaScript no lado do servidor.

Via: Ajaxian


Email por Walter Cruz em Lua, JavaScript, Apache
Tags: apache, javascript, lua, tsilva, v8

Comentários no código 3 - mais wordpress

27/12/2008

É, uma coisa boa do código é que ele sempre pode ser modificado, para melhor ou para pior (e nós sempre fazemos de tudo para que seja para melhor!)

Por exemplo, o arquivo wp-admin/includes/template.php, no Wordpress 2.6 começava da seguinte forma:


//
// Big Mess
//

// Ugly recursive category stuff.
 

Hoje em dia, o comentário é:


/**
 * Template WordPress Administration API.
 *
 * A Big Mess. Also some neat functions that are nicely written.
 *
 * @package WordPress
 * @subpackage Administration
 */


// Ugly recursive category stuff.
 

Além disso, a maiora das funções nesse arquivo começou a ganhar alguma documentação do PHPDOC... ;)


Email por Walter Cruz em PHP, Geek life
Tags: comentarios no codigo, wordpress

Zine: engine para blog em Python

26/12/2008

Lançar software no dia 24 de dezembro, quem diria? Foi o que os caras da pocoo fizeram.

Pra quem não os conhece, o pessoal da pocoo lançou o pygments (uma biblioteca que faz sintaxe highlight em código e suporta diversas linguagens), o Jinja (uma engine de templates, inspirada na engine de templates do Django) e o Werkzeug (que pode ser visto mais apropriadamente como um framework web Python).

No dia 24 eles lançaram a versão 0.1 do Zine, uma engine de blog escrita em Python, usando framework Werkzeug e o SQLAlchemy. Você pode ver alguns screenshots, baixar o projeto e ler a FAQ no site do projeto.

Segundo o site, Armin Ronacher começou a desenvolver o Zine após se cansar do código do WordPress e constantar que não haviam boas engines de blog escritas em Python. Sucesso ao projeto!


Email por Walter Cruz em Python, Frameworks
Tags: python, wordpress, zine

Notícias para quem usa mercurial

11/12/2008
  • No dia 2 de dezembro foi lançada a nova versão do Mercurial, a 1.1. Entre as novidades, compatibilidade com Python 2.6, maior conformidade com o padrão WSGI e o suporte a rebase através de uma extensão. Mais informações nas Notas de Lançamento.
  • A ferramenta de buscas de código do google, o codesearch, ganhou suporte a repositórios no git e no mercurial no último dia 09. Agora é possível procurar lá coisas como do Mozilla, JDK e NetBeans, que são três softwares cujo repositório de código é gerenciado pelo mercurial. Mais no Blog do Google Code.
  • O tópico do fórum do ohloh pedindo suporte ao mercurial é sempre movimentado. Nessa semana, começou um movimento espontâneo dos usuários, dizendo que fariam doações para que o mercurial fosse logo suportado pelo ohloh. Para a alegria dos usuários, Robin Luckey (um dos desenvolvedores do ohloh) apareceu na thread dizendo que nas próximas semanas ele vai trabalhar no código do ohloh para que o suporte a novos sistemas de controle de versão sejam adicionados de forma mais transparente.

Boas notícias para quem usa o mercurial para gerenciar seus códigos fonte!


Email por Walter Cruz em Python
Tags: git, mercurial, scm, svn

1 2 3 4 5 6 7 8 9 10 11 ... 33 >>